Analysis

In 2024, pharmacists in Jordan stood at 21.1. That is the highest value across all 23 years on record.

The figure is up 1.7% on the previous year and up 51.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, pharmacists in Jordan peaked at 21.1 in 2024 and was at its lowest, 6.97, in 1998.

Jordan ranks 2nd of 166 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 23 years of available data.
